M4 Sherman - HDR Photo
The M4 was named after General William Tecumseh Sherman, used in WWII in the American Army and the Allied forces.Production of the M4 exceeded 50,000 units.
Here an exhibit in the Tank Museum Munster/Germany.
The next tanks in row are the British "Comet" (Ben Hur) and an "Archilles".
